1. State Legislatures: Vidhan Sabha & Vidhan Parishad
India's state legislatures can be unicameral (only Vidhan Sabha) or bicameral (Vidhan Sabha & Vidhan Parishad). Their structure and functions are outlined in Articles 168-212 of the Constitution.
Composition & Strength
Vidhan Sabha (Legislative Assembly): Directly elected members from territorial constituencies. Strength varies from 60 to 500, with exceptions for smaller states.

Economic Profit: Economic profit = Revenue - Explicit Costs - Implicit Costs
Example: A firm earns $500,000 in revenue, explicit costs of $300,000, & implicit costs of $50,000.
Economic Profit = 500,000 - 300,000 - 50,000 = 150,000 (positive economic profit).
